Request for Proposals (RFP) is a document that solicits proposals, often made through a bidding process, by an agency or company interested in procurement of a commodity, service, or valuable asset, to potential suppliers to submit business proposals.
Request for Proposals (RFP) may be filed by government agencies, private companies, or organizations seeking to purchase goods or services.
To fill out a request for proposals (RFP), one must carefully read the document, understand the requirements, prepare a proposal addressing the criteria outlined, and submit it by the specified deadline.
The purpose of a request for proposals (RFP) is to provide a fair and transparent process for selecting the best vendor or supplier to meet the needs of the organization.
A request for proposals (RFP) typically includes information such as the scope of work, project timeline, evaluation criteria, terms and conditions, and submission instructions.
